Is there a guide for how mod and tool authors should configure Crowdin somewhere? My experience trying to configure Crowdin for translation has not been smooth, and I imagine I've reinvented a lot of wheels that have been built many times by other people:
- I had to dig around to figure out a way to use a mix of language codes ("de") and locale codes ("zh-TW"). It seems like there should be a better way to configure that.
- I want to support language fallbacking. I couldn't find that in Crowdin directly, so I set skip_untranslated_strings in crowdin-translation-action.yml with the intention of postprocessing the files. But Crowdin deleted all the English texts when I did that.
- I uploaded the existing English texts to fix the previous problem, and Crowdin added double-quotes around a bunch of the values.
- I would like to include context information directly in english.cfg, (or at least in the github repo) but I don't see a way to supply context information through the github action.
